Otorhinolaryngology

Outline
The Department of Otorhinolaryngology was established in January, 1974, with Professor Koichi Yamashita (now Professor Emeritus at 色多多视频) as the first Chair of the Department. Professor Yamashita played an active role in contributing to the development of rhinology, as a pioneer of endoscopic sinus surgery in Japan. In April, 1997, Professor Koichi Tomoda became the second Chair of the Department and exerted influence on the development of surgical devices for endoscopic sinus surgery. Professor Takaki Miwa became the third Chair of the Department in May, 2009 and has started a very unique and novel outpatient service for olfactory and gustatory disorders. Our main research field is the clinical and basic research of olfaction and we are leading the field both nationally and internationally.
